Spatial database of morphometric features based on basin approach is developed for Krasnoyarsk region. The water basins are ranged into four levels. The digital model of hydrography network developed by VSEGEI was used, in combination to Whitebox GAT, QGIS and ArcGIS software. The average climate features are calculated due to this digital model, and spatial analysis supported with advanced non-linear statistics is provided.
